At 5 PM today, on October 26, the Realme XT will officially make its debut in Pakistan. This smartphone from Oppo's sub-brand was first released in India back in September. In the meantime, we've also seen it in other Asian countries.


It's a flagship-level smartphone yet still expected to be priced near the mid-ranged bracket like it is in the other markets where it's available. Rumor has it that you'll need to pay anywhere from PKR 44,999 to 50K+ for an 8GB +128GB unit and we are not yet certain if the lower end variants like 6GB/64GB or 4GB/64 GB will ever make it to the local market. Realme XT has a 6.4-inch Super AMOLED display with 1080 x 2340 Pixels resolution, a 64 MP quad rear camera setup, a 16 MP selfie snapper, and a 4,000 mAh battery.

Realme Buds

Realme Buds, the wired in-ear headphones come with a higher frequency and 11 mm audio drivers for powerful sound. These are also the first earphones in this price range that come with built-in magnets.

The cable is made of break-resistant synthetic fiber that protects it from wear and tear. It also sports the braided jacket that not only feels premium but also prevents the cable from tangling. The ear tips are bend at 45° for snug wear and are also lightweight and comfortable. With the remote, you can control music, handle calls, and even launch Google Assistant. Realme Wireless earphones

The Buds Wireless earphones come with a neckband-style design made of Nickel-titanium memory allow string. It gets a slim rubber neckband with metal houses on either end that rests on your collar bone. The neckband is flexible with just the right amount of rigidity that lets it sits comfortably around the back of your neck. It is soft and light with a skin-friendly silicone gel so you won't even realize it's there. In fact, the entire Buds Wireless feel quite light, including the plastic earbuds. This is part of the reason the earbuds are comfortable to use for hours together.


The other reason is the silicone ear tips, which are extremely soft and sit well inside the ears. You get add-on wingtips as well, which are great especially for workouts. The wings rest within the shallow depression in your ear to make sure the buds firmly stay in place even if you move your head vigorously. These are also IPX4 splash resistant and support fast charging giving you 12 hours of listening time on one charge and an additional 100 minutes with just 10 minutes of charging.


Realme power bank

Determining the need for power banks realme power bank has a battery capacity of 10,000mAh and a weight of 230 grams. It provides bidirectional fast charging of 18w. Equipped with USB Type-A and USB Type-C ports, the device enables multiple devices to charge.
